Role of AI in Application Engineering: Intelligent Error Detection

Authors

  • Murali Kadiyala

DOI:

https://doi.org/10.52783/kjsdd.282

Keywords:

Artificial Intelligence, Test Driven Design (TDD), Debugging, Railtown AI, Decision trees, Neural networks, Support vector machines and Random forests, K-fold cross validation]

Abstract

The use of artificial intelligence (AI) in application engineering specifically, intelligent error detection is highlighted in this work. Some important components of artificial intelligence (AI) in application engineering-intelligent mistake detection are pattern recognition, real-time data monitoring, and predictive analysis. Several tactics have been effective. Some AI models look at version control histories to identify code changes that might introduce issues. Others use natural language processing to look for differences between code and documentation. Runtime monitoring solutions utilize machine learning to detect anomalous activity that suggests underlying issues. The integration of these technologies is resulting in more reliable apps with shorter debugging cycles for development teams. AI helps developers instead of replacing human expertise by handling repetitive detection tasks, allowing them to focus on technical improvements and innovative problem-solving. Simply said, AI can be used for intelligent error detection since it contributes to early bug detection, developer efficiency, and software quality maintenance.

Downloads

Published

2024-12-26

Issue

Section

Articles